    Quote Originally Posted by tits3ris*y View Post
    Late registration na ako. Then, gusto ko din sana i-transfer ownership na. Alin uunahin ko para pinakamabilis at matipid ang process? Tips? Thanks! :*
    isabay nyo po.
    with notarized deed of sale and OR CR (and emissions test na rin para sigurado), go have your pc clearance.
    then, after a few days, when you get your clearance, get the requisite tpl insurance, and proceed to the LTO where the car was first registered, and present all the documents. after some waiting (1 hour or so, maybe less, depending on the crowd and the computer's availability), you will be presented with your very own OR and CR, with your name on it.

    bring xerox copies of the originals that you must also bring, just in case.
